Two steadfast singles learn that the game of love has risks and rewards in this captivating Matchmaking Mamas romance following Once Upon a Matchmaker .
In one corner we have Jared Winterset, who's not in the market for a wife. He knows too well how few marriages succeed—and Jared hates failure. So he'll keep it light.
In the other corner there's Elizabeth Stephens, a self-sufficient violinist. She's lonely sometimes, but playing her music is more rewarding—and safer—than playing the field.
Then a certain someone calls in the Mamas, and— ding! —Jared and Elizabeth are thrown together, planning a thirty-fifth wedding anniversary party. Soon the two are enjoying themselves way too much. It won't last, thinks Elizabeth. It's fun, that's all, thinks Jared. But they're about to learn that in a real love match, both players can win . . .
